Pär Åkerblom is a seasoned professional with a wealth of experience in program management and business application development, particularly within the Microsoft ecosystem. As a former Principal Program Manager in the Dataverse and Power Platform team at Microsoft, Pär played a pivotal role in shaping and enhancing a comprehensive suite of business applications that includes Dynamics 365,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I, and Power Virtual Agents. His expertise in ERP systems and financial accounting has allowed him to drive projects that not only streamline processes but also deliver significant value to organizations leveraging these platforms.
Throughout his tenure at Microsoft, which began in 2008, Pär was instrumental in leading key projects that focused on integrating advanced analytics and automation into business workflows. His proficiency in program management and project management methodologies, including Kanban, enabled him to effectively oversee cross-functional teams and offshore software development initiatives. This experience has equipped him with a deep understanding of financial reporting and fixed asset management, making him a valuable asset in any enterprise environment.
